Commercial development should be at an intensity or level of use <br />consistent with Residential/Professional (RP) or Neighborhood Commer- <br />cial (C-1) which in turn would be compatible with adjacent residential <br />development. <br /> <br />8. Effective screening, berms, or landscaping should b~ provided along <br />all arterials--Beltline Road~ Barger Avenue, and Highway 99 North--in <br />an effort to minimize existing and future negative impacts from these <br />art-er i a 1 s . <br /> <br />9. A profile of existing residential development should be considered. <br /> <br />Understanding that future residential development will be medium <br />and high density in nature, least. dense development in the development <br />node study area should occur near existing single-family developments <br />with higher densities closer to Barger Avenue. Appropriate setback <br />and screening must be considered between Barger Avenue and proposed <br />development within the study area. <br /> <br />10. A mixture of housing types and number of bedrooms per unit should <br />be considered. <br /> <br />11. Development options should be considered, including the establishment <br />of phase lines based on a comprehensive plan for the area. <br /> <br />The study site contains approximately 100 acres; such a development <br />would not be within the feasibility of a single, small developer. <br /> <br />12. Planned unit development procedures should be used to review <br />residential development. <br /> <br />13. Based on the intensity of future development within the development <br />node, and its impact on existing developed adjacent land and traffic <br />concerns, site review procedures should provide an adequate process <br />for reviewing future development within the RP or C-1 zoning districts <br />and th~ir 'proximity to. existing and proposed land uses. <br /> <br />'.. -.6: :.: '< ~.:.l ... ~." ~ .; "..-:: '...
